The Art of Crafting Selvedge on Traditional Looms

A key element of selvedge denim’s heritage depends on the intricate craftsmanship involved with its production. Selvedge denim is woven on traditional shuttle looms, which can be slow and labor-intensive but bring about fabric of exceptional quality.

These specialized looms create fabric with a self-edge or finished edge that prevents unravelling. The procedure needs a top level of skill and precision because the looms meticulously weave the threads, causing a visually appealing and tightly woven fabric.

Significance From the Self-Edged Finish

The self-edged finish is really a distinctive sign of selvedge denim fabric. It is produced by tightly weaving the weft thread into the fringe of the fabric, forming a clean, narrow edge.

This self-edged finish not just adds aesthetic appeal but additionally increases the fabric’s durability. The tightly woven edge prevents fraying and unraveling, ensuring the longevity of selvedge denim garments.

Weight and Texture Differences

Premium selvedge denim fabrics vary in weight and texture, permitting a personalized experience. The weight of the denim means the ounce measurement per square yard. Heavier weights, such as 14-ounce denim, offer durability as well as a stiffer feel, while lighter weights, like 10-ounce denim, give a softer and much more comfortable fit. Texture-wise, selvedge denim displays a strict and uniform weave, developing a distinct visual appeal.

Comparing Sanforized and Unsanforized Variants

In terms of selvedge denim, the two main primary categories: sanforized and unsanforized. Sanforized denim has undergone a preshrinking process, reducing the chance of significant shrinkage after washing. This makes sanforized selvedge denim easier and much easier to tend to. In the other hand, unsanforized selvedge denim has not undergone the pre-shrinking process, leading to initial shrinkage. However, unsanforized denim delivers a unique fading potential and allows for a personalized match wear and subsequent washes. Choosing between sanforized and unsanforized selvedge denim ultimately depends on personal preference and desired fading patterns.

Decoding the Terminology: Raw, Washed, and Fades

In the world of selvedge denim, comprehending the terminology is important to fully appreciate this amazing fabric. Let’s decode a number of the popular terms connected with selvedge denim: raw, washed, and fades.

Precisely What Does ‘Raw’ Denim Really Mean?

‘Raw’ denim refers to untreated fabric which includes not undergone any pre-washing or distressing processes. It will be the purest kind of selvedge denim, showcasing the fabric in their natural state. Raw denim is prized because of its possible ways to develop unique fading patterns and personalized character with time through the wearer’s individual journeys and experiences.

The Journey from Raw to Washed: The Process Explained

The transformation from raw denim to washed denim involves an intricate process. After buying raw selvedge denim, the garment is worn for an extended period without washing. The fabric gradually molds to the wearer’s body, creating distinct creases and fades. If the time comes for washing, the raw denim is soaked or gently washed to remove dirt and stains while preserving the unique fading patterns developed. Washing and subsequent wear will further boost the individualization in the denim.

Fading Patterns and Personalization Through Wear

One of the very remarkable aspects of selvedge denim is the actual way it ages and develops fading patterns. The indigo dye used to color the fabric gradually fades with wear and wash, causing distinctive and personalized fade patterns. These fades vary based on the wearer’s lifestyle, activities, and habits. From striking honeycombs behind the knees to whiskers nearby the fly, the fading patterns on selvedge denim tell a unique story of personalization and individual style.

Fading Pattern Description
Honeycombs Distinct fading patterns that resemble honeycomb-shaped creases behind the knees.
Whiskers Fading patterns that form nearby the fly, resembling whiskers.
Stacks Vertical fading patterns that occur due to the stacking in the denim on the hem.
Fade Lines Horizontal fading patterns that occur across the thighs along with other high-stress areas.

Washing Methods For Longevity

When it comes to washing selvedge denim, gentle handling is essential. Here are a few washing techniques to help prolong the life of your selvedge denim:

  1. Turn the denim inside out before washing to minimize fading and preserve the colour.
  2. Wash in cold water to avoid excessive shrinkage and color loss.
  3. Use a mild detergent specifically designed for denim or even a gentle, pH-neutral detergent.
  4. Stay away from bleach or harsh chemicals that will weaken the fabric and cause damage.
  5. Choose hand washing or perhaps a delicate cycle on your own washing machine to minimize abrasion.
  6. Air dry your selvedge denim instead of using the dryer to avoid shrinkage and maintain its shape.

Avoiding Common Mistakes in Denim Care

There are some common mistakes that you need to avoid when caring for selvedge denim to make certain its longevity:

  • Avoid frequent washing. Selvedge denim doesn’t must be washed as much as other types of denim. Washing many times can result in color loss and lack of the unique fades that develop with time.
  • Avoid tumble-drying. The heat from your dryer may cause shrinkage and damage the fabric. Air drying is recommended to preserve the fit and form of selvedge denim.
  • Avoid using harsh detergents. Harsh detergents can strip the fabric of its natural oils and cause it to lose its original quality and appearance.
  • Avoid rubbing or scrubbing stains aggressively. Instead, gently blot the stain having a clean cloth then wash as recommended.
  • Avoid ironing at high temperatures. Excessive heat can flatten the unique texture of selvedge denim. If needed, make use of a low-temperature setting or steam iron.

Tips For Tailoring an Ideal Selvedge Denim Jacket

A well-fitted denim jacket can elevate your style and add a bit of sophistication to any outfit. Below are great tips to assist you tailor the perfect selvedge denim jacket:

  • Get started with the right size: Select a jacket that matches well in the shoulders and chest, since these areas are definitely the most difficult to alter. The length and sleeve width may be adjusted accordingly.
  • Identify the alterations needed: Measure the areas that require modification, such as the sleeve length, waistline, or overall silhouette. Talking to an expert tailor may help you determine the best alterations to your specific needs.
  • Fabric considerations: Keep in mind that certain alterations may be more challenging with selvedge jeans custom because of its structured and sturdy nature. Discuss fabric-specific alterations along with your tailor to make certain they have the required expertise and equipment.
  • Experiment with style details: Selvedge denim jackets offer opportunities for customization through unique style details like contrasting stitching, personalized buttons, or embroidered patches. Consider adding these factors to create your jacket truly one-of-a-kind.

Custom Fitting Selvedge Jeans: Tips

The beauty of selvedge jeans depends on their ability to become tailored for your specific measurements to get a custom fit. Here’s a step-by-step guide that will help you achieve the perfect fit:

  1. Know your measurements: Take accurate measurements of your waist, hips, inseam, and thigh circumference to determine your ideal jean size.
  2. Pick the right style: Select a selvedge jean style that fits your body type and personal preferences. Consider factors including rise, leg opening, and overall silhouette.
  3. Talk to a tailor: Seek the assistance of a competent tailor who may have experience dealing with selvedge denim. They can direct you with the fitting process and recommend alterations that can boost the overall fit and comfort of your jeans.
  4. Consider wash-related alterations: Some selvedge jeans require initial shrinkage, also referred to as “waist soak,” to get the desired fit. Check with your tailor about pre-soaking options as well as any additional alterations needed after the initial wash.
  5. Break them in: Selvedge denim needs time to mold to your body and develop natural fade patterns. Wear your custom-fitted selvedge jeans regularly to make sure they adapt and conform to your distinct shape over time.
